Today, Southwest Airlines announces our intent to serve Honolulu, HI (Oahu); Kahului, HI (Maui); Kona, HI (Island of Hawaii); Lihue, HI (Kauai). While we do not yet have details to share on exact dates or routes, they do represent our initial footprints and top priorities for the soonest service in the State of Hawaii.

Southwest will come in with lower fares and Hawaiian and others will have to match them.  I predict intro $99.00 one way fares (you heard it here first  Smiley Very Happy  ).  But when the dust settles...SW  will probably end up having the same airfares to the mainland as all the others. And that goes for inter-island as well.  And Hawaii has never had assigned seating on inter-island flights until Hawaiian Airlines became a monopoly. So Hawaiians are very use to the concept. What "will" make Southwest very popular here is their policy of no change or baggage fees.  Will the other airlines match those policies? I don't think so.
